Poetry as a Passageway

La Mama Poetica July welcomes you into the somatic, unifying poetry of multidisciplinary artist Tariro Mavondo. Rose Lucas reads from her new book ‘Remarkable as Breathing’ (Liquid Amber Press, 2024), inspired by reflective and contemplative practice. Brendan Ryan, author of ‘Feldspar’ (Recent Work Press, 2023), unflinchingly explores rural landscapes and the people and animals that inhabit them. And we invite you into the alert, sharply observant poetry of genderqueer transfemme poet Josie/Jocelyn Suzanne.

Featuring Tariro Mavondo, Rose Lucas, Brendan Ryan & Josie/Jocelyn Suzanne

Hosted by Amanda Anastasi


Poetica July 2024 will also be livestreamed. Livestream playback will be available for 72 hours after the show.
